Calums Cabin Cottage!!

It gives me great pleasure to announce (some of you perhaps have heard already) that Calums Cabin purchased what has to be known as “Calums Cabin Cottage”, at the beginning of November.  Calums Cabin Cottage will be to the same high standard that Calums Cabin is, and will allow families to come and make as many memories as possible.

Last year, as a committee we were very aware that we were turning away so many families, and one of our long term aims had always been to try and find Calums Cabin No 2.  Well this happened a little sooner than expected, but with the help of Radio Clyde’s Cash for Kids, and The Sir Hugh Fraser Foundation , it became a reality.  The cottage is being whipped up to shape as I write this, and of course, same as the cabin and the shop, it will have some John Amabile magic worked on it, which will bring it up to luxery standard.

We as a committee are really really excited about our next step forward, and what a difference it will make, 104 families will be able to holiday on Bute in comparion to the 52 that we have been able to help in the last 3 years come February.  I can’t believe that come next month, that will be the cabin open 3 years, where does the time go, but what I can tell you is by reading all the memory books, all the children and families that have visited, have taken something special away with them from their time there, and the same will be said of Calums Cabin Cottage.  It is located nearer the town, but has views over Rothesay Bay, and looks onto woodland, so still has the peace and tranquility that we always said that whether it be Calums Cabin or Calums Cabin Cottage, should have.

Hopefully within the next few weeks, we will be able to publish pictures of the cottage, and bookings are being taken already.

So if you are thinking of contacting us, looking for availability you have double the chance this year, thanks to so many individuals and the two trusts that I have mentioned.  Thank you.

The “Summer House is under construction”

Today saw the build of the summer house start, ok I know it is winter but we have been waiting for ages for this to happen, it is being built by Ayrshire Log Cabins and has been designed by Brian Stewart our Patron, and equipped inside by John Amabile our other patron.  Hopefully by the end of the week the summer house will be up and then we can get the electrics in and start the interior.  Thank you so much to the Wooden Spoon Charity for sponsoring the summer house, it will make such a difference to the children and families staying at the cabin, to be able to be outside but inside at the same time.  Hopefully once it is finished I shall be able to show you some pics!!
